### What is the Synth Eradicator in Magic: The Gathering?

Synth Eradicator is a rare artifact creature card from the 2024 Fallout set. It has the Soldier subtype and costs three mana to play, featuring abilities that allow you to exile cards from your library for energy or deal damage.

### What does the foil finish mean for this card?

The foil finish indicates that the card has been printed with a reflective, metallic treatment, distinguishing it from standard nonfoil versions. This parallel is often sought after by collectors for its visual appeal and potential scarcity within the set.
